
A T-MOUNT is made up of an inner ring with an internal M42x0.75 thread, and an external ring which is the camera fitting. The two are held together by 3 peripheral grub screws. Slackening these screws allows orientation of the T accessory relative to the camera. T MOUNTS fit to the T thread on the back of the accessory just like a screw bottle top. Each T Mount is a different thickness to accommodate the difference in film plane/lens flange register lengths of the various camera systems. In this way accessories designed for infinity focus or parfocality will focus correctly.
They are commonly used to fit film and digital SLR cameras to microscope and telescope adaptors, slide copying units, mirror lenses etc.
Please note the T thread is M42x0.75, not the Pentax/Praktica/Zenith M42x1 thread.
